    We come to Homestead pretty much at least once every week that they're open. It's a really solid…read moreplace for lunch with outside seating, so someplace we can bring our dog. It's a small family run place that carries various farm products, homemade baked goods, and they have a great selection of made-to-order lunch items, that they will kindly customize to your liking. On Fridays, they usually have fried chicken sandwiches and no joke, their fried chicken patties are the best I've ever had. I always get mine with American cheese and bacon and it's perfect. There's always a weekly special, which is often quite good. The chicken, bacon, ranch panini is always solid. My son loves the chicken quesadilla. My other kiddo loves the breakfast burger. We've tried probably everything on the menu and it's all solid. They also have fries and sweet potato fries (which come included with many of the items) which are plentiful. I like the sweet potato fries a bit better. The items that don't come with fries come with your choice of potato salad or coleslaw. I'm not a fan of either so I've never tried them here. As for drinks, they carry beer, Jaritos, coffee, Iced Tea, and some others. The desserts that we've tried have been quite good. Obviously if we make it a point to come here weekly, we're big fans of Homestead Marketplace.
